The fund has significant flexibility to achieve its investment objective and invests in a broad range of income-producing securities, including debt and equity securities in the U.S. and other markets throughout the world, both developed and emerging. The manager currently intends to gain exposure to debt securities principally through investments in underlying funds, including mutual funds and/or ETFs within the same group of investment companies (i.e., J.P. Morgan Funds).
